Εἴπε πάλιν, ὅτι Ἔστιν ἄνθρωπος δοκῶν σιωπᾶν, καὶ ἡ καρδία αὐτοῦ κατακρίνει ἄλλους· ὁ τοιοῦτος πάντοτε λαλεῖ. Καὶ ἔστιν ἄλλος, ἀπὸ πρωϊ ἔως ἑσπέρας λαλῶν, καὶ σιωπὴν κρατεῖ· τουτέστιν ὅτι ἐκτὸς ὠφελείας οὐδὲν λαλεῖ. Ἀποφθεγματα των ἀγιων γεροντων, Παλλαδιος |
Again Father Poemen said, 'There is a man who seems to be silent and in his heart he condemns another, and so this man is speaking all the time. There is another man who talks from dawn until dusk and maintains silence, that is, he speaks only what is profitable.' Sayings of the Desert Fathers, Palladius of Galatia |
